Using Sanding Poles for Installing Decorative Chip Floors

Most installations of decorative chip flooring implement the use of a flat trowel or floor buffing machine with a brush to knock down chips.

One tip to reduce stress on your back and improve overall reach / fit into spaces where machines can’t, is to use a painter’s sanding pole to knock down the chips before sealing the floor.

The procedure is as follows:

  • Remove the majority of chips/flakes quickly to remove the bulk.
  • Use a painter’s swivel head sanding pole with #80 – #100 grit paper or screen.
  • With the sanding pole swipe the chips quickly from side to side as well as forward and back, working backwards.
  • Once you get a feel for it you will pick up speed and be done with a nice flat floor.
  • Remove the excess chips once more and you’re ready for your grout coat.
